One of the first challenges customers encounter is identifying the right type of insulation for their specific needs. Rubber and plastic thermal insulations come in various forms, each designed for different applications. For instance, rubber insulation is known for its flexibility and superior thermal resistance, making it ideal for piping systems in industrial settings. On the other hand, plastic insulation, particularly closed-cell foam, is lightweight and moisture-resistant, making it suitable for residential applications.
To tackle this issue, it’s crucial to start by clearly defining your insulation goals. Are you looking to reduce energy costs? Or is your primary concern condensation and moisture control? By outlining your specific needs, you can narrow down which type of insulation will serve you best.
Another significant concern for buyers is the quality of insulation materials. With numerous brands available, it can be overwhelming to assess which products offer the best performance. A common pitfall involves selecting lower-cost options that seem appealing but may lack proper thermal resistance.
According to research from the U.S. Department of Energy, the right insulation can reduce energy costs by up to 30% in homes. This statistic emphasizes the importance of investing in quality materials. Look for products that are certified by recognized organizations, such as the ASTM (American Society for Testing and Materials), as these certifications ensure the materials meet specific performance standards.
Price comparison is another common hurdle when purchasing thermal insulation. Many buyers may opt for the cheapest option without considering long-term benefits, leading to subpar performance and costs in the long run. Understanding the total cost of ownership—initial purchase price plus installation and maintenance costs—is essential.

Even once you've selected the right insulation product, installation issues can arise. Improper installation can lead to gaps, which significantly reduces the effectiveness of the insulation. One common scenario is incorrectly measuring and cutting insulation pieces, resulting in wasted materials and time.
To overcome this, consider seeking professional installation services, especially if you are unfamiliar with thermal insulation techniques. Alternatively, many manufacturers provide detailed installation guides and tutorials—don't hesitate to utilize these resources.
